California Code of Civil Procedure 415.46 provides that an owner of property may serve a prejudgment claim of right to possession form on a tenant as part of an unlawful detainer action. An unnamed occupant who wants to fight the eviction must complete the prejudgment claim form and file it with the court. (a) In addition to the service of a summons and complaint in an action for unlawful detainer upon a tenant and subtenant, if any, as prescribed by this article, a prejudgment claim of right to possession may also be served on any person who appears to be or who may claim to have occupied the premises at the time of the filing of the action. When filing an unlawful detainer , or eviction, a landlord has the option to serve a Prejudgment Claim of Right to Possession to all unknown occupants.
